In 1843, Samuel Wesley Coe entered the world in Pennsylvania, United States of America, born to David M Coe And Jane Jemima Coe. In 1880, Samuel Wesley Coe resided in Pierce City, Lawrence, Missouri, USA. Samuel Wesley Coe married Margaret J Timmons, and had children including Georgie Grace Coe, Infant Coe, Katie Mae Pranter, Merle S Coe, Nellie Coe. Samuel Wesley Coe passed away in 1918 in Springfield, Greene County, Missouri, United States of America.
